Reflection INSTRUCTIONS EXERCISES Exercise 1:  Favorite video game and what makes this game great?  Introduction to R.E.P.O REPO is a fast-paced, survival horror indie video game that plunges players into a futuristic world where debt collection is dangerous at high stakes. The players are tasked to collect valuable assets from heavily armed defaulters across the universe within the game. There are obstacles to be faced during each level, the higher you go the more harder it gets to deal with monsters.   The video game was launched in February 26, 2025. LECTURES WEEK 1: LECTURE 01 Typographic Systems 8 major variations:  Axial Radial Dilational Random Grid Modular Transitional Bilateral The typographic systems are what architects term 'shape grammars'. These systems are similar that the systems set of rules are unique and it provides a sense of purpose that focuses and directs the decision making. (Elam, 2007) While these systems may seem to limit creativity, they actually help learners build a strong foundation.
